LAPD Announces Promotions and Movement Among Command Staff

June 29, 2005

Los Angeles:  Today, Los Angeles Police Chief William J. Bratton announced several key promotions and transfers among his Command Staff as he continues to reorganize the Department to better utilize talents and experience.  These personnel changes affect a total of 19 command staff officers, 11 of whom will be promoted or upgraded.

“As we progress toward making LA a safer place, it’s my pleasure to announce promotions among my command and staff officers,” said Chief of Police William J. Bratton.  “These law enforcement professionals have demonstrated the ability to lead and motivate.  They will represent LAPD and the City well.”
